WOJSKOWY INSTYTUT TECHNIKI 是由 PCA 认可的实验室,认可编号 AB 083(波兰)。认可范围涵盖 11 项检测方法,涉及以下领域:材料与高分子。检测对象包括:金属、合金 金属材料制品、结构材料,含装甲与装甲防护板;附加防弹护板;防弹玻璃;门、窗、百叶与窗帘、Metals, metal alloys, non-metals, ceramics, textile materials, poly…、Iron alloys。

认可范围 — 项检测方法 (11)
| 序号 | 检测对象 | 方法 / 参数 | 技术 | 依据文件 | |
|---|---|---|---|---|---|
| 检测方法 | |||||
| 1 | 金属、合金 金属材料制品 | HBW hardness Range: ball diameter 2,5 mm, 5 mm Brinell method | PN-EN ISO 6506-1:2014-12 | ||
| 2 | 金属、合金 金属材料制品 | HRB, HRC hardness Range: scale B, C Rockwell method | PN-EN ISO 6508-1:2016-10 | ||
| 3 | 金属、合金 金属材料制品 | HV hardness Range: HV 5, HV 10, HV 30 Vickers method | PN-EN ISO 6507-1:2018-05 | ||
| 4 | 金属、合金 金属材料制品 | Absorbed energy Range: KV KU 2; 2 Initial hammer energy: 300 J Test temperature: - (23 ± 5) ˚C - temperature reduced to -40 ˚C Charpy impact test | PN-EN ISO 148-1:2017-02 | ||
| 5 | Iron alloys | Content of elements: C, Mn, Si, P, S, Cr, Ni, Cu, Mo, V, Al, W, Ti, Mg Range: C (0,01 -1,5) % Mn (0,01 - 1,7) % Si (0,01 - 2,5) % P (0,005 - 0,1) % S (0,005 - 0,1) % Cr (0,01 - 20,0) % Ni (0,02 – 12,0) % Cu (0,01 - 0,4) % Mo (0,01 – 4,0) % V (0,01 - 0,6) % Al (0,005 - 0,2) % W (0,01 – 2,0) % Ti (0,01 - 0,3) % Mg (0,01 - 0,1) % Method: Spark atomic emission spectrometry | PN-H-04045:1997 PB 05/LIM | ||
| 6 | Metals, metal alloys, non-metals, ceramics, textile materials, polymer composites, plastics, rubber | Microstructure Fracture features Chemical composition: - qualitative analysis Scanning electron microscopy | PB 30/LIM, wyd. 4 z 17.03.2021 r. | ||
| 7 | Metals, metal alloys, non-metals, ceramics, textile materials, polymer composites, plastics, rubber | Resistance to climatic conditions Range: - temperature (-50 ÷ 150) ˚C - relative humidity up to 98 % | PB 41/LIM, wyd. 4 z 17.03.2021 r. | ||
| 8 | Metals, metal alloys, non-metals, ceramics, composites, plastics | Surface geometry: - roughness - waviness Contact profilometry method | PN-EN ISO 4287:1999 PN-EN ISO 21920-2:2022-06 PN-74/M-04255 | ||
| 9 | 结构材料,含装甲与装甲防护板;附加防弹护板;防弹玻璃;门、窗、百叶与窗帘 | Bullet resistance Range: projectile calibre up to 30 mm Method for testing resistance to penetration by projectiles | STANAG 4569, edycja 3 STANAG 4569, edycja 4 PN-EN 1523:2000 PN-EN 1063:2002 PB 11/LIM, wyd. 7 z 25.03.2025 r. | ||
| 10 | 结构材料,含装甲与装甲防护板;附加防弹护板;防弹玻璃;门、窗、百叶与窗帘 | Ballistic limit V50 Range: standard projectiles and fragments Penetration resistance test method | MIL-STD-662F wyd. XII 1997 MIL-DTL-46100E z 11.02.2009 MIL-DTL-12560K z 11.09.2020 PB 46/LIM, wyd. 2 z 17.03.2021 r. | ||
| 11 | 结构材料,含装甲与装甲防护板;附加防弹护板;防弹玻璃;门、窗、百叶与窗帘 | Determination of the critical ricochet angle | PB 51/LIM z 31.08.2023 | ||
